8,693,508 (eight million six hundred ninety-three thousand five hundred eight) is an even 7-digit number. It is a composite number with 12 divisors, and factors as 2² × 3 × 724,459. Its proper divisors sum to 11,591,372, more than the number itself, making it an abundant number.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x84A704.
